Prerequisite: ACCT 205 and 206 with a grade of C or better in each course. An in-depth study of financial accounting theory and practice, with emphasis on the preparation of financial statments in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les. Topics covered include the conceptual framework of accounting, the standard-setting process, and the time value of money, current assets (cash, receivables, and inventories), spreadsheet applications, and ethical considerations. Three hours of lecture.
